Murder suspect may be in Ireland

Giedrius Dubosas, 36, who is wanted in connection with the death of a man in his native Lithuania in 2005

A Lithuanian murder suspect could be living in Ireland, police have said.

Giedrius Dubosas, 36, is wanted in connection with the death of a man in his native Lithuania in 2005.

Dubosas, who uses the nickname Sabonis, may be living in in Co Monaghan or across the border in Co Armagh, Tyrone.

He is described as being five foot six inches tall (1.68m), weighs about 15 stone (95kg) and has green eyes.

A spokesman for the Police Service of Northern Ireland said a European Arrest Warrant had been issued.
